What is in season in New Hampshire right now
Seasons start late and end fast; summer is short and intense, and frost usually closes things down by October. These crops are usually at their peak across New Hampshire around August. Availability at The 1780 Farm depends on what it grows and on how the season has run this year.

- What produce is at its peak in New Hampshire in August?
- Around August in New Hampshire, apples, apricots, blackberries, blueberries, cantaloupe & melons, and cherries are typically at their peak. Availability at any one farm depends on what it grows and on the year's weather.
